Before searching for a construction loan, you should have a licensed builder. If you haven’t done this, then you should just forget about obtaining the loan now. Although lender may offer the money for different projects, they can never risk lending money when there is no licensed builder. There should also be a profitability record from the builder. The lender has to see these details before issuing the construction loan. hence, you should have this documentation when going to look for a loan.

Another important thing you need to do is to compile the building details. Other than only hiring a licensed contractor, you have to provide particular details regarding your project. They have to see detailed floor plans, even cost projections and comprehensive materials inventories. If you don’t give these details, they will assume that you are hiding something and reject your application. This will put you in a fix especially if you don’t have building experience. Your home also has to be evaluated and valued before seeking the loan. The value of the home will determine how much is lent to you. It is also advisable to look for an appraiser to value your home. You need a blue book compiled for your home. One of copy of the blue book should be handed over to the lender for easy processing. The appraisers also use the blue book to calculate the value of your project.

Prior to getting this loan, you need to have a down payment ready. Even when your loan is approved, most lenders will demand a down payment before disbursing the loan. This will act as a commitment and also to avoid losses to the lender. Again, you will need to show that you can repay the loan. This can be done with a credit report. Latest paycheck copies may also be necessary to prove this.
